so in the thread for the sale today it says the sale is at 3PM PDT, but then it mentions UTC/GMT-7 which would be mountain time

what the hell is going on--

Ok, CF wants people schooled on timezones... GMT-7 is Mountain STANDARD which is not the current timezone in the Mountain zone, it's also Pacific DAYLIGHT, which IS the current TZ for Pacific.  When DST changes in November (or whenever the F they changed it to) then it will not be PDT it will be PST in California which will be GMT-8. 

So right now... California is in PDT, PDT is GMT-7 and 3PM PDT is 10:00PM GMT/UTC
